Scheffler ties 72-hole PGA record in CJ Cup Byron Nelson romp
Top-ranked Scottie Scheffler matched the lowest 72-hole score in PGA Tour history on Sunday, overwhelming the field to complete a wire-to-wire victory at the CJ Cup Byron Nelson tournament.
